Блог

Final Cut для iPad

Я много создаю контента и снимаю видео и когда у меня накрылся мак, то некоторое время я собирал видео на iPad-е и всё было отлично, но все же по возможностям Luma Fusion всё же сильно проигрывает Final Cut pro и для меня основной проблемой является отсутствие коррекции цвета. 

Делаю автокомплитер на Blazor

Для моего приложения нужен автокомплитер и поэтому я решил его реализовать вручную. Это самая простая реализация прямо в коде элемента. Автокомплитер лучше реализовать в виде отдельного контрола, что я скорей всего сделаю чуть позже. Все бусти видео здесь.

30 лет в ИТ, что дальше?

Когда мы общались после конференции в баре с ребятами, то затронули одну очень интересную тему - а что дальше? Я всегда плыл по течению и не думал о том, что будет дальше, как-то оно приходило само собой. Новое видео: 30 лет в ИТ, что дальше?

Фишки C# 12 моими глазами

Я пока не нашёл даты выхода C# 12, скорей всего он станет частью .NET 8 и его можно пощупать, если скачать превью. Майкрософт представили несколько новых фишек, самая крутая из них наверно вот эта:

Школьный аккаунт на Маке

У дочки на маке перестал работать Visual Studio, потому что истекла лицензия. При старте появлялось окно для входа с MS аккаунтом, но при этом окно стилизировано под Seneca (колледж в Канаде) и не позволяло войти под своим аккаунтом. При попытке выбрать – войти под другим аккаунтом VS продолжал требовать именно Seneca аккаунт. 

Изучаем Blazor вместе

Я решил всё же попробовать Blazor и в плюсе я опубликовал первое видео, в котором на практике и своём реальном пет проекте проюую Blazor. Все видео плюса здесь. Я всегда говорю, что учится нужно на практике, совершать ошибки и продолжать двигаться дальше и изучать. В новом блоке видео я буду писать сайт и одновременно изучать с вами Blazor. 

17-й эпизод сайта на .NET

Сегодня на бусти стал доступен 17-й эпизод, в котором я строю сайт на .NET. Все видео здесь.

Отчет о конференции по безопасности - AppSecFest

Я только вернулся из Казахстана с конференции AppSecFest, которая проходила в Алматы и в этом видео я решил поделиться результатами. Это мой первый опыт выступления на сцене конференции и было очень круто и приятно увидеть столько людей, которым нравится моё творчество. Отчет о конференции по безопасности - AppSecFest

Начал смотреть в сторону Blazor

Для своего проекта, на бусте сайта с резюме я думаю, что использовать - React или Blazor. Сегодня решил попробовать Blazor, и мне понравилось. Очень удобно работать и очень просто всё реализовано. Возможность писать на C# фронтенд - это сокращение количества необходимых для знания технологий. Если раньше нужно было знать DB + C# + HTML + JS + CSS, то с Blazor из этой цепочки можно вычеркнуть JS, который сам по себе требует месяцы обучения. 

XSS + CSRF

На Бусти появилось 40-е видео и снова про безопасность. В этом видео я объединю проблемы XSS и CSRF и на примере моего сайта покажу, как можно обновить данные для текущего пользователя. Все мои бусти видео здесь.

О блоге

Программист, автор нескольких книг серии глазами хакера и просто блогер. Интересуюсь безопасностью, хотя хакером себя не считаю

Обратная связь

Без проблем вступаю в неразборчивые разговоры по e-mail. Стараюсь отвечать на письма всех читателей вне зависимости от страны проживания, вероисповедания, на русском или английском языке.

Пишите мне